#e3fdfe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e3fdfe is composed of 89% red, 99.2%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 0.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 182.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 94.3%. #e3fdfe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c7fbfd.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#e3fdfe color description : Light grayish cyan.

#e3fdfe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e3fdfe has RGB values of R:227, G:253,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 14941694.

Shades and Tints of #e3fdfe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a0a is the darkest color, while #f6fe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3fdfe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#f0f1f1 is the less saturated color, while #e3fdfe is the most saturated one.
